LIQUID FILTER ASSEMBLY FOR USE WITH TREATMENT AGENT AND METHODS
First Claim
1. A liquid filter assembly comprising:
- (a) an outer housing having a bottom and a side wall and defining an interior;
(b) a top plate including a plurality of liquid flow entry apertures and a threaded exit aperture;
(c) a filter cartridge positioned within the housing interior;
the filter cartridge comprising media extending between first and second end caps;
(i) the media defining and surrounding an open center;
(ii) the first end cap having an open central aperture; and
, (iii) the second end cap being a closed end cap;
(d) an internally received treatment agent storage and release cartridge having a ring shape and positioned within the housing interior between the filter cartridge and the top plate;
(i) the treatment agent storage and release cartridge including an outer wall, an inner wall and an end wall;
(ii) the inner wall surrounding and defining a central flow channel around which the treatment agent storage and release cartridge is positioned, as a ring;
(iii) the treatment agent storage and release cartridge being positioned with the central flow channel in exit flow communication with the open center defined by the media;
(iv) the inner wall around the central flow channel having no diffusion apertures therein;
(v) the end wall having a diffusion aperture arrangement of at least one diffusion aperture therethrough; and
(vii) the outer wall having diffusion apertures therethrough; and
(e) a first gasket positioned between the treatment agent storage and release cartridge and the top plate at a location between the liquid flow entry apertures and the top plate threaded exit aperture;
(f) the treatment agent storage and release cartridge being positioned;
(i) with the end wall of the storage and release cartridge directed toward the top plate; and
(ii) with all diffusion apertures in the treatment agent storage and release cartridge only providing flow communication between an interior of the treatment agent storage and release cartridge and a region exterior to the treatment agent storage and release cartridge, on an opposite side of the first gasket from the threaded exit aperture, and into a region between the first gasket and the outer housing side wall.

Abstract
A liquid filter arrangement including an internally received treatment agent storage and release cartridge is provided. The assembly is configured for diffusion of the treatment agent from the treatment agent storage and release cartridge, into liquid flowing through the filter arrangement. A particular arrangement shown is configured which provides for a dynamic type of liquid flow providing a current directed through the treatment agent storage and release cartridge. In the preferred arrangements, an initial static type of flow followed by later dynamic flow, is provided. Alternatives, methods of assembly and descriptions of use are provided.
